What the inspection camera does

This is a small waterproof camera on a 16.4 ft semi-rigid cable that plugs into your phone. It captures clear video and stills at 1920 × 1440, throws light from eight adjustable LEDs, and bends where you need it — behind panels, down drains, into engine bays — then shows the live image on your screen.

How to use it

Connect the cable to your phone with the right adapter, open the app, and feed the probe into the space. Use the LED slider to light the area, and steer the semi-rigid cable with one hand while you watch the screen with the other.

Rinse and dry the probe after use in wet or dirty areas, and coil the cable loosely so it keeps its shape. The accessories — magnet, hook, mirror — clip on when you need to retrieve a dropped screw or see around a corner.

Specifications

Specifications Details
Resolution 1920 × 1440 (over 2.0MP)
Cable 16.4ft (5m) semi-rigid, IP67
Lighting 8 adjustable LED lights
Probe 7.9mm diameter
Compatibility iPhone (Lightning), Android (Type-C / micro-USB)
Power Phone-powered, no separate battery
In the box Adapters, magnet, hook, mirror, hood, manual
Best for Home repair, drains, engines, HVAC
